Losing your keys or misplacing your reading glasses occasionally is a normal part of daily life, but losing items constantly and frequently—your wallet, phone, important documents, even items you just set down minutes ago—may signal something more serious. Neurologists increasingly recognize persistent item misplacement as a potential early warning sign of cognitive decline, including early-stage dementia. Unlike the occasional forgetfulness everyone experiences, this pattern reflects underlying changes in memory consolidation and executive function that warrant medical evaluation. Consider a 62-year-old woman who finds herself searching for her car keys multiple times each week, unable to remember where she placed them despite retracing her steps. Her family notices she’s also asking the same questions repeatedly and misplacing grocery receipts, medications, and household items with growing frequency.

When she finally sees a neurologist, cognitive testing reveals mild memory impairment—one of the early indicators that precedes a formal dementia diagnosis. Her constant item loss wasn’t mere absentmindedness; it was a symptom reflecting how her brain was processing and storing information differently. The distinction matters significantly. Healthy aging involves occasional memory lapses, but the frequency, pattern, and accompanying cognitive changes in constant item loss cases often indicate disruption in the brain regions responsible for attention, working memory, and object location memory. Early detection through recognizing these patterns can lead to earlier diagnosis, allowing individuals and families to plan ahead and potentially benefit from interventions that may slow cognitive decline.

What Do Neurologists Mean by “Constant Item Loss” as a Dementia Sign?

Neurologists define constant item loss as a persistent, increasing pattern of misplacing objects—not just occasionally forgetting where something is, but regularly and frequently losing the same categories of items. This differs from normal forgetfulness in both frequency and impact on daily functioning. Someone might lose their keys three or four times per week rather than once or twice monthly. Importantly, when they search for the item, they often cannot retrace their steps or recall placing it in specific locations, suggesting the memory wasn’t encoded clearly in the first place. This pattern reflects dysfunction in specific cognitive domains. The brain regions involved in attention, working memory, and spatial awareness—particularly areas in the prefrontal cortex and medial temporal lobe—work together to create and retrieve memories of object placement.

When these regions begin to deteriorate due to neurodegenerative changes, the brain fails to properly register or store information about where an object was placed. The person may place their phone on the counter but have no memory encoding that action, so when they later search for the phone, there’s genuinely nothing to retrieve from memory. This contrasts sharply with normal aging, where someone might forget but can eventually remember by retracing steps or seeing the object. Neurologists also look for the escalating nature of the problem. A person in early dementia doesn’t maintain a stable low level of item loss; instead, the frequency increases over months. Additionally, constant item loss typically accompanies other subtle cognitive changes—slightly slower processing speed, difficulty finding words, or challenges with complex tasks like managing finances—that together paint a picture of cognitive decline rather than isolated forgetfulness.

How Does Memory Encoding Break Down in Early Dementia?

Memory encoding—the brain’s ability to convert an experience into a storable memory—requires intact neural pathways and efficient communication between brain regions. In early dementia, particularly in Alzheimer’s disease, amyloid plaques and tau tangles begin accumulating in areas crucial for encoding memories. The hippocampus, essential for forming new memories and spatial awareness, is often affected early. As these structures deteriorate, the brain struggles to process and store everyday information about routine actions like placing an item down. When someone has healthy memory encoding, placing your wallet on the nightstand involves multiple cognitive processes working together: visual attention (noticing the nightstand), intentional action (putting the wallet down), and memory consolidation (encoding that action). In early dementia, one or more of these processes may falter.

The person might place the wallet while distracted or in a different cognitive state, meaning the action never gets properly encoded. Later, when searching for the wallet, they have no memory to retrieve because no clear memory was formed. This is fundamentally different from someone with normal aging who might remember placing the wallet but misremember the location—the memory exists but is flawed. A critical limitation in relying solely on item loss as a diagnostic indicator is that other conditions can cause similar patterns. Attention deficit disorders, medication side effects (particularly anticholinergics), thyroid dysfunction, and high stress can all increase item loss frequency. Depression and anxiety can impair concentration and increase forgetfulness. This is why neurologists never diagnose dementia based on item loss alone; they conduct comprehensive cognitive testing, medical evaluations, and often imaging studies to rule out other causes before attributing the pattern to neurodegenerative disease.

What Other Cognitive Changes Accompany Constant Item Loss?

Constant item loss rarely occurs in isolation during early dementia. It typically appears alongside other subtle cognitive changes that together create a recognizable pattern. Many people with early dementia also experience word-finding difficulties—they know what they want to say but can’t retrieve the specific word, leading to pauses or descriptions like “that thing for cooking” instead of “oven.” They might repeat the same story multiple times within a short period, unaware they just shared that information. Tasks requiring planning and organization, like preparing a multi-course meal or managing household bills, become noticeably harder. A typical example involves a 68-year-old man whose spouse notices he’s losing items constantly but also taking longer to understand conversations, asking people to repeat themselves more often, and struggling to recall recent conversations from earlier in the day. His handwriting has become slightly messier, and he’s become less adventurous about trying new restaurants or activities, preferring familiar routines.

Together, these changes—not constant item loss alone—prompt evaluation that reveals mild cognitive impairment with progression toward dementia. The item loss is one thread in a broader tapestry of cognitive change. These accompanying symptoms matter because they help distinguish dementia-related item loss from other causes. Someone with anxiety might misplace items frequently but would also report specific anxious symptoms and typically can remember placing items with prompting. Someone with ADHD would have had lifelong item loss struggles; dementia’s constant item loss represents a change from baseline functioning. Neurologists always take a detailed history asking when the item loss began relative to other cognitive changes, making it a marker within the larger clinical picture rather than a standalone symptom.

When Should You Seek Neurological Evaluation?

The timing of evaluation matters significantly. Seeking assessment early—when cognitive changes are subtle and memory loss is mild—allows for earlier diagnosis and intervention. However, not every instance of misplaced items warrants immediate neurological concern. Experts suggest considering evaluation when item loss represents a clear change from your baseline, occurs frequently (multiple times per week), and brings functional consequences. If you’ve always been somewhat absent-minded but haven’t worsened, occasional item loss is likely normal.

If you were previously reliable about tracking possessions and now constantly search for everyday items, evaluation becomes more appropriate. Key indicators that warrant scheduling a neurological appointment include: the pattern has worsened noticeably over months rather than remaining stable, you’re losing more types of items or losing them more frequently, family members have expressed concern about your memory, you’ve noticed other cognitive changes like word-finding difficulty or confusion, or the item loss significantly impacts your ability to function independently. Some people avoid evaluation because they fear a dementia diagnosis, but early evaluation offers the advantage of potentially accessing treatments designed to slow progression and allowing time for life planning and family communication. The comparison between normal aging and concerning patterns is important. Normal aging might involve occasionally forgetting where you parked at the mall or losing track of a pair of socks; concerning patterns involve repeatedly losing your car in the parking lot despite clear parking lot layouts, or misplacing essential items like medications, glasses, or financial documents multiple times weekly. One is occasional frustration; the other represents a functional decline that disrupts daily life and raises safety concerns, particularly if someone forgets where they placed medications or important documents.

How Do Neurologists Assess Item Loss as a Symptom?

Neurologists use standardized cognitive testing to evaluate the memory and attention problems underlying constant item loss. Tests like the Montreal Cognitive Assessment (MoCA) or Mini-Cog assess attention, working memory, and executive function—the very domains impaired in early dementia. During these tests, a person might be asked to remember and later recall a list of words, copy complex designs, or perform timed cognitive tasks. These structured assessments are far more reliable than reported item loss alone because they objectively measure cognitive performance. Neurologists also take detailed histories from both the patient and, ideally, a spouse or family member who can provide outside perspective.

They ask: When did the item loss start? How frequently does it occur? Are you losing specific categories of items or everything indiscriminately? Can you find items by retracing your steps? Have there been other cognitive changes? This contextual information shapes interpretation. Someone who began losing items two months ago alongside word-finding difficulties presents a different picture than someone who’s been casually misplacing things throughout life without worsening. A significant limitation in assessing item loss is that some people under-report it due to denial or poor insight into their cognitive changes—a phenomenon called “anosognosia” in dementia. A spouse might report constant item loss while the person insists they rarely lose things. This discrepancy between self-perception and observable reality actually increases concern for cognitive decline, because awareness of one’s cognitive abilities also deteriorates in dementia. Neurologists must navigate these reports carefully, weighing both perspectives and conducting objective testing rather than relying solely on subjective accounts of item loss frequency.

What Role Does Attention Play in Item Misplacement?

Attention is the gateway to memory encoding—you cannot remember what you never properly attended to. In early dementia, attention often deteriorates subtly before obvious memory loss becomes apparent. When someone places their glasses down while watching television or having a conversation, their attention may be divided between the placement action and the show or conversation. A healthy brain can handle this divided attention and still encode the action; an aging brain with emerging cognitive decline may fail to register the placement adequately.

This explains why people with early dementia often lose items during divided-attention situations. They place their wallet on the counter while talking to family, or remove their watch while listening to the news. In these moments, their primary attention is elsewhere, and the brain fails to encode the incidental action. A person with healthy aging might also struggle more with divided-attention encoding, but the difference is degree—someone in early dementia shows pronounced difficulty even with routine divided-attention tasks. Interestingly, when these individuals focus full attention on placing an item, they often succeed; but in real life, people don’t maintain intense focus on routine actions like putting down daily items.

Future Directions in Early Detection and Cognitive Support

Research continues exploring how technology might support early detection of cognitive decline through monitoring patterns of item loss and related cognitive changes. Some researchers are investigating whether smartwatch sensors, location-tracking devices for frequently lost items, or smartphone apps that log daily cognitive difficulties might provide early warning signs of dementia. These tools could help bridge the gap between subjective reports and objective assessment, potentially catching cognitive decline earlier than traditional clinical visits allow.

Meanwhile, interventions for people already experiencing constant item loss and mild cognitive impairment are evolving. Beyond medication, cognitive rehabilitation, structured routines, simplified environments, and external support systems (like key tracking devices, designated storage locations, or smartphone reminders) can help maintain independence and quality of life. Research on cognitive training and lifestyle factors—sleep, exercise, cognitive engagement, social interaction—suggests these modifiable factors may influence cognitive trajectory. While constant item loss may signal early dementia, acknowledging and addressing it early opens doors to both medical and lifestyle interventions that may slow progression and preserve functioning longer.

Frequently Asked Questions

How is constant item loss different from normal forgetfulness?

Normal forgetfulness is occasional and stable over time; you might forget where you parked once a month but usually remember with effort. Constant item loss in early dementia occurs multiple times weekly, worsens over months, and involves items you cannot recall placing despite searching. The key difference is frequency, pattern escalation, and functional impact.

Can medication cause constant item loss?

Yes, certain medications—particularly anticholinergics used for allergies, overactive bladder, or Parkinson’s disease—can impair memory and attention. High-dose sedatives, some blood pressure medications, and medications affecting the central nervous system can increase forgetfulness. A neurologist will review medications as part of evaluation to distinguish medication effects from dementia-related decline.

At what age should I worry about item loss as a dementia sign?

Early-onset dementia can occur in people in their 40s or 50s, though dementia becomes more common with advancing age. The concern is less about absolute age and more about change from baseline—if your memory was reliable throughout life and suddenly becomes unreliable, that warrants evaluation regardless of age. Conversely, lifelong mild forgetfulness without worsening is less concerning at any age.

What tests will a neurologist perform to evaluate item loss?

Neurologists typically conduct cognitive screening tests (like MoCA or Mini-Cog), detailed history from you and a family member, physical examination, and often brain imaging (MRI) or blood tests. These objective measures are far more informative than reported item loss alone. Testing might also include a more comprehensive neuropsychological battery depending on initial results.

Can someone recover memory function if diagnosed early with dementia?

Currently, no dementia has a cure, but early diagnosis allows access to medications (like cholinesterase inhibitors for Alzheimer’s disease) that may slow progression. Lifestyle modifications—exercise, cognitive engagement, quality sleep, social interaction, Mediterranean diet—also show evidence of supporting cognitive health. Early intervention and comprehensive management offer the best opportunity to preserve functioning longer.

How can I reduce item loss if I’m experiencing it?

Practical strategies include establishing consistent storage locations for frequently misplaced items, using key trackers or location devices, setting phone reminders to place items in specific spots, simplifying your environment to reduce clutter, and minimizing divided-attention situations when possible. However, increasing item loss should prompt medical evaluation rather than relying solely on compensatory strategies, as it may indicate an underlying condition requiring professional attention.
